Towns & Cities: Kołaczyce

also known as Kolashitz, Kolatchitz, Koloshitz, Kolachitze

Town overview

Modern town name: Kołaczyce, Poland
Latitude and Longitude: 49.8075, 21.4347
49°49' N , 21°26' E
Galician (Austro-Hungarian) Administrative District: Jasło
Interwar (Polish) District: Jasło
Interwar (Polish) Province: Kraków

Gesher Galicia is a non-profit organization carrying out Jewish genealogical and historical research on Galicia, formerly a province of Austria-Hungary and today divided between southeastern Poland and western Ukraine. The research work includes the indexing of archival vital records and census books, Holocaust-period records, Josephine and Franciscan cadastral surveys, lists of Jewish taxpayers, and records of Galician medical students and doctors - all added to our searchable online database. In addition, we reproduce regional and cadastral maps for our online Map Room. We conduct educational research and publish a quarterly research journal, the Galitzianer. Gesher Galicia is also organized for the purpose of maintaining networking and online discussion groups and to promote and support Jewish heritage preservation work in the areas of the former Galicia.
